6605 Mayfield Rd, Mayfield Heights, Ohio 44124
(440) 605-1985
Walgreens locations & hours near Mayfield Heights
2 miles
5644 Mayfield Rd, Lyndhurst, Ohio 44124
(440) 646-2314
3 miles
751 Richmond Road, Richmond Heights, Ohio 44143
(440) 442-3368
4 miles
4365 Mayfield Rd, South Euclid, Ohio 44121
(216) 691-0897
5 miles
2135 Warrensville Center Rd, South Euclid, Ohio 44121
(216) 932-0937
6 miles
20485 Euclid Ave, Euclid, Ohio 44117
(216) 531-1466
6 miles
5881 Som Center Rd, Willoughby, Ohio 44094
(440) 946-4357
6 miles
20200 Van Aken Blvd, Shaker Heights, Ohio 44122
(216) 751-4521
7 miles
3020 Mayfield Rd, Cleveland Heights, Ohio 44118
(216) 932-4759
7 miles
14525 Euclid Ave, East Cleveland, Ohio 44112
(216) 851-1472
8 miles
16400 Chagrin Blvd, Shaker Heights, Ohio 44120
(216) 561-4007
8 miles
22401 Lake Shr Blvd, Euclid, Ohio 44123
(216) 261-4497
8 miles
15609 Lake Shore Blvd, Cleveland, Ohio 44110
(216) 383-3803
8 miles
4071 Lee Rd, Cleveland, Ohio 44128
(216) 561-1318
8 miles
33693 Vine St, Eastlake, Ohio 44095
(440) 918-0700